Rooftop solar panels decrease your energy costs and carbon footprint by generating tidy and affordable electricity for your home. Setup prices are less expensive than ever before and photovoltaic panels function well with various other clever technology like batteries and warm pumps too., and more people are picking them annually. Solar panels are roof-mounted systems that record the sunlight's energy, converting it right into electrical energy for your home.
Solar panels work especially well on roofing locations that deal with south and are not shaded by trees or various other buildings.

This assistance should be followed when a consumer has picked which power tool they want to set up. Installer needs to be appropriately signed up. Establish if you needy to inform the Circulation Network Operator (DNO) before or after installment. Mount power device. Some energy effectiveness plans need application before installment of power device.
In Scotland, all building guideline compliance matters are managed by the regional authority building standards services. Setup specialists ought to constantly consult them to validate whether there is a requirement for a structure warrant. Find the information of your regional authority in: Energy gadget owners must commission an installment professional, talk about the proposed installation and acquire the energy gadget.
Setup contractors can: register with a proficient persons scheme. In many conditions, this enables setup professionals to self-certify that your job conforms with developing regulations. If not signed up, installation specialists need to go straight to the Neighborhood Authority Building Control and pay to submit a building notification before the start of the installation work.
ENA have actually generated Distributed Generation and Storage Space Link Guides (Solar panel installation), which consists of a flowchart to assist develop which kinds need to be finished and whether they need to be submitted prior to or after installment. When the installment specialist has actually identified whether the link is 'link and notify' or 'apply to connect', they need to adhere to the appropriate instructions: Installers can continue to install the device and send the appropriate Design Referral (EREC) G98 application to the DNO within 28 days of installment.
This should be sent prior to installation yet reduces the connection time to 10 days or much less.
